Output 96696d1814a2a74fba06ed2ab05c9d606748e0d4c2e235eb95fe3093887b801e:35

value
38830000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 989e17e7641b1d9a2856550b17d944cb25bd061b OP_EQUALVERIFY OP_CHECKSIG
address
1Euy6gMKnzYVkvVLadG8F84HNVZJuBHVPf
transaction
96696d1814a2a74fba06ed2ab05c9d606748e0d4c2e235eb95fe3093887b801e
spent
true